Summary:
The Group Creative Director – Global Brand Environments will report to the Vice President of Brand Creative and be part of our passionate brand experience team. He/she will oversee all Under Armour storytelling within branded environments and ensure all campaigns and projects are facilitated from creative development through final execution. These environments include UA stores, UA partner Stores (Shop in shops), UA showrooms, Trade Shows, UA events and Virtual environments (Virtual Reality).
